Hey Guys. I am from moorhead,mn Up by fargo. I was just wondering if any of you daily drive your 350z? I don't own one right now but I am looking at getting a new car and was wondering if they daily driver friendly in our snowy state?

Thanks Guys!

Welcome.

Not in the winter, most of us store them. If you do drive it in the winter then snow tires are a must, but for a little more money you could just pick up a POS to punish in the snow/salt and keep the Z looking better longer.
